What is Marketing Qualified Lead (MQL)?

Summary

Marketing Qualified Leads (MQLs) are potential clients who have demonstrated a certain level of interest in a company's product or service based on their engagement with marketing efforts. MQLs are typically identified through a lead scoring system that takes into account a prospect's behavior and demographics, such as filling out a form, downloading a whitepaper, attending a webinar, or visiting a certain number of specific web pages. Once a prospect has been identified as an MQL, they can be passed on to the sales team for further nurturing and conversion into a client.

What is the purpose of identifying Marketing Qualified Leads?

The purpose of identifying MQLs is to focus marketing efforts on leads that are most likely to become clients, improving budget allocation. By analyzing their behavior and demographics, companies can tailor their marketing strategies to move them through the sales funnel, resulting in higher conversion rates and ROI.

How does MQL ranking work?

MQLs are identified by a set of variable criteria, ranging from segmentation data to engagement and interaction tracking scores, that indicate their potential to become clients. Once identified, MQLs are passed on to sales teams for further nurturing and conversion into sales qualified leads (SQLs).

MQLs work by helping teams prioritize leads based on their level of engagement and interest, ensuring that sales teams are focusing their efforts on leads with the highest potential to convert into paying clients.

Why are MQLs important?

As the correct identification of MQLs helps marketing teams focus their efforts on leads most likely to convert, MQLs can be leveraged to increase the efficiency of sales pipelines, increasing conversion rates and ultimately accelerating revenue generation. Furthermore, marketers able to identify and qualify MQLs are able to seamlessly transition them over to sales departments, where they will be engaged in further nurturing and, ideally, convert into clients.
